A professional and welcoming office environment is important and reflects the company’s values and culture; we shouldn’t underestimate this. The perception of clients and potential employees can be negatively affected by a workplace that is outdated, overcrowded, or disorganized. Modernizing your office space through an office remodel will reinforce your brand image and leave a positive lasting impression. Moreover, optimizing space utilization is crucial, particularly in response to evolving needs. Renovations can optimize spatial efficiency, accommodate ergonomic furnishings, and enhance organizational systems. It should be emphasized that a thoughtfully designed workspace can lead to improved productivity and a stronger bottom line.
